Day 1:
CALGARY. Enjoy time at leisure to relax or do some independent exploring. Your Tour Director is on hand this evening to answer any questions.

Day 2:
CALGARY–BANFF. The discovery of oil converted this all-western cattle ranching town into a thriving, sophisticated city. See many of the city’s attractions this morning on your sightseeing tour, including downtown, the Olympic Ski Jump, and Saddledome. Then motor west through the foothills of the Rockies and into BANFF NATIONAL PARK. Upon arrival, take the optional gondola ride up Sulphur Mountain for panoramic views of Banff’s spectacular scenery. Then enjoy a visit to sparkling Bow Falls.

Day 3:
BANFF. Full day at leisure. Banff is one of Canada’s favorite resorts, with summer activities that include hiking, boating, and fishing. Your Tour Director will suggest a half-day optional helicopter ride over the Canadian Rockies. Tonight there’s an optional cruise on Lake Minnewanka.

Day 4:
BANFF–LAKE LOUISE–JASPER NATIONAL PARK. First stop is Lake Louise, its cold waters reflecting the surrounding mountains and glaciers. Precipitous gorges, snow-capped mountain ranges and exquisite lakes come into view as the motorcoach scales two mountain passes. Another highlight on today’s agenda is a stop at the COLUMBIA ICEFIELD to experience the Ice Explorer, an all-terrain vehicle that travels on ice measuring 365-meters (1,200-feet) thick. Upon arrival in Jasper, an orientation tour to see Jasper’s unspoiled beauty. Late this afternoon, join our optional raft trip down the historic Athabasca River. Your accommodation for the next two nights will be in JASPER NATIONAL PARK.

Day 5:
JASPER. Join the optional trip to Maligne Lake for a narrated cruise. On the return journey, stop to view Maligne Canyon. With much of the afternoon and evening free, you might hike along the trails and look for elk.

Day 6:
JASPER–ROCKY MOUNTAINEER TRAIN–KAMLOPS. An exciting morning as you board the Rocky Mountaineer for a two-day, all-daylight, classic rail journey from the Canadian Rockies to the Pacific Coast. You may see Mount Robson, the highest mountain in the Canadian Rockies, and follow the route of the “Overlanders,” 19th-century homesteaders who attempted to settle this rugged region. Follow the Thompson River and enjoy vistas of the Monashee Mountains. Overnight in Kamloops. Tonight, join our optional dinner outing to a popular theatre performance. (B,L)

Note: Continental breakfast and a cold lunch are included on board the Rocky Mountaineer;snacks and non-alcoholic drinks are also provided free of charge. It will be necessary to pack an overnight bag for the train journey. Suitcases will be checked for the entire journey and will be unavailable for the overnight at Kamloops. No porterage service is available in Kamloops.

Day 7:
KAMLOPS–ROCKY MOUNTAINEER TRAIN–VANCOUVER. Reboard the train and head through the ranchlands along the South Thompson River. Continue through the stark beauty of Fraser Canyon and the turbulence of mighty Hell’s Gate. Then pass through the fertile fields of the Fraser Valley, surrounded by the snowcapped Coast Mountains. Arrive in Vancouver at the Rocky Mountaineer Station in early evening and transfer to your hotel. (B,L)

Day 8:
VANCOUVER–VICTORIA. Morning sightseeing focuses on Vancouver’s Chinatown, Gastown, the beautiful beaches and harbor, and lovely STANLEY PARK. Afterward, set sail across the Strait of Georgia through the spectacular Gulf Islands, an area known for its Mediterranean-like climate. Afternoon sightseeing in Victoria includes world-famous BUTCHART GARDENS, Bastion Square, and Thunderbird Park with its unusual collection of totem poles.
